Interestingly, there is a massive "return to roots" movement. Ancient superfoods like millets, turmeric, and moringa—staples in grandmothers' kitchens for centuries—are being rebranded as modern wellness essentials. Historically, the joint family system was the bedrock of an Indian woman’s life. She would enter her husband’s home as a bahu (daughter-in-law), learning the hierarchies and rhythms of a multi-generational household. This system provided a safety net—shared childcare, financial support, and emotional security. However, it also came with immense pressure, loss of autonomy, and for many, the quiet tyranny of expectations. In a typical household
In a typical household, the woman is the CEO of domesticity . She manages the kitchen inventory, tracks extended family birthdays, coordinates prayers, and upholds the family’s social reputation. Even among working professionals in Mumbai or Delhi, the "mental load" of household management still falls disproportionately on the woman.

The lifestyle and culture of Indian women represent a dynamic fusion of ancient traditions and modern independence. Today, Indian women navigate a complex social landscape where heritage guides family life while education and economic empowerment reshape their professional roles.
